    Name 6-(4,4,5,5-Tetramethyl-1,3,2-dioxaborolan-2-yl)-1H-indazole

    Get Quote
    Basic Information

    Synonyms: 6-(tetramethyl-1,3,2-dioxaborolan-2-yl)-1h-indazole 1h-indazole,6-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)-

    Molecular Formula: C13H17BN2O2

    Molecular Weight: 244.1

    MDL Number: MFCD07368067

    Product Description:
    1H-Indazole-6-boronic acid pinacol ester is a heterocyclic organoboron compound featuring a boronic ester group attached to the 6-position of the 1H-indazole core. This structure makes it a versatile and valuable building block in modern synthetic chemistry, particularly in cross-coupling reactions such as the Suzuki-Miyaura reaction. Its primary application is as a key intermediate in the pharmaceutical industry for the synthesis of various drug candidates and active pharmaceutical ingredients (APIs). The indazole scaffold is a privileged structure in medicinal chemistry, found in compounds targeting a range of therapeutic areas, including oncology and central nervous system disorders. The boronic ester functionality allows for efficient, palladium-catalyzed coupling with aryl or heteroaryl halides, enabling the rapid construction of complex, drug-like molecules. As a protected form of the corresponding boronic acid, this pinacol ester offers improved stability and handling characteristics compared to the free acid, making it a preferred reagent for storage and use in multi-step synthetic sequences. It is a standard item in catalogs of fine chemicals and building blocks for drug discovery.
    Physical Properties

    Melting Point: 134-139 °C

    Boiling Point: 404.1°C at 760 mmHg

    Flash Point: 198.2°C

    Density: 1.15g/cm3
